I level faith to like 15 no matter what build I do just for heals alone. The only game I’ve found it pointless to do that in is ds3 - plus stats are pretty limited in that game. Arcane is a weird stat. It increases item discovery, and it increases status build up (bleed, madness, poison, sleep, etc), and it also is a stat that weapon damage scales with. It’s also a requirement for the dragon incantations - meaning a bleed build goes hand in hand with a dragon build. Bleed builds are also very good with both strength and dex weapons. Any arcane build is very strong. In general if you want a good build, you choose either dex or strength, then either arcane/faith, pure faith, pure int, or pure arcane. Arcane/int unfortunately is not the best combo.

Strafe. Strafe. Strafe. People complain about the rolling in this game but fail to realize that rolling is borderline pointless in this game when compared to strafing. I also think the emphasis on strafing in this game makes you significantly better at spacing and strafing in other games. Even ds3 can get trivialized with proper strafing, but ds2 is where it’s the most prominent.
